The Bethesda LTACH is located in the former St. Joseph’s facility. Founded by the Sisters of St. Joseph of Carondelet in 1853 St. Joseph’s is proud to hold the distinction as Minnesota's first hospital. This unit is an excellent place to build expertise in handling patients with progressive care issues at varying levels of multi system impairment. The LTACH is an inpatient unit where all our patients have had a complex illness or injury that requires hospital level care for an average of 25-30 days. Many of our patients are more acute than a typical Med/Surg floor.
